About Our Carolina Beach Court Resurfacing

Court resurfacing extends the life of an existing court by another 7-10+ years for a fraction of the cost of a full rebuild. We pressure wash, repair cracks and surface defects, apply acrylic resurfacer, color coat with SportMaster ProcourtPlus or ColorPlus, and re-stripe to current regulation. Ideal for HOA amenity courts and worn residential courts that have started fading or cracking.
